    if (fileNames.size() == 0) {
      // if no files given, read from stdin / write to stdout
      MessageCatalog msgCat = FormatRegistry.getMessageCatalog(arguments.getType());
      writeMessages(msgCat, readAndProcessMessages(pipeline, msgCat, System.in), System.out);
      return;
    }

    // get the suffix to use for output file names
    String suffix = arguments.getVariant();
    if (suffix == null) {
      suffix = "_pseudo";
    } else {
      suffix = "_" + suffix;
    }

    for (String fileName : fileNames) {
      File file = new File(fileName);
      if (!file.exists()) {
        System.err.println("File " + fileName + " not found");
        continue;
      }

      // get the extension of the input file and construct the output file name
      int lastDot = fileName.lastIndexOf('.');
      String extension;
      String outFileName;
      if (lastDot >= 0) {
        extension = fileName.substring(lastDot + 1);
        outFileName = fileName.substring(0, lastDot) + suffix + "." + extension;
      } else {
        extension = "";
        outFileName = fileName + suffix;
      }
      System.out.println("Processing " + fileName + " into " + outFileName);

      // get the message catalog object for the specified (or inferred) file type
      String fileType = arguments.getType();
      if (fileType == null) {
        fileType = extension;
      }
      MessageCatalog msgCat = FormatRegistry.getMessageCatalog(fileType);

      // read and process messages
      InputStream inputStream = new FileInputStream(file);
      List<Message> processedMessages = readAndProcessMessages(pipeline, msgCat, inputStream);
